Latest Patents

One of Ki Su Kim's latest patents is titled "Fusion protein comprising IDS and use thereof." This invention describes an asymmetric fusion protein that combines a fragment of an antibody binding to an insulin receptor, an iduronate-2-sulfatase (IDS) enzyme, and an Fc region. This fusion protein is notable for its ability to cross the blood-brain barrier (BBB), allowing for the delivery of the IDS enzyme to the brain. Consequently, a pharmaceutical composition containing this fusion protein can serve as a therapeutic agent for central nervous system diseases, particularly in preventing and treating conditions caused by ribosome accumulation.

Another significant patent is "Anti-CD3 antibody and pharmaceutical composition for cancer treatment comprising same." This invention relates to an anti-CD3 antibody that exhibits high affinity and specificity for CD3. As a result, it can be effectively utilized in the prevention or treatment of cancer.
